Babanusa vs El Seybo Climate & Distance Between

Dominican Republic flag
  • The distance between Babanusa, Sudan and El Seybo, Dominican Republic is approximately 10,309 km or 6,406 mi.
  • To reach Babanusa in this distance one would set out from El Seybo bearing 77.1°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Babanusa bearing 109.7° or ESE .
  • Babanusa has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h) whereas El Seybo has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
  • Babanusa is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as El Seybo is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
  • The average temperature is 2.6 °C (4.7°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 5 °C (9°F) more in Babanusa.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 854.2 mm (33.6 in) less which is equivalent to 854.2 l/m² (20.96 US gal/ft²) or 8,542,000 l/ha (913,196 US gal/ac) less. About 3/8 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.3° higher in Babanusa than in El Seybo.
